What Is an SMM Panel—and Why Is It Important?
SMM stands for Social Media Marketing, and an SMM panel is essentially a dashboard or marketplace that offers social media services—like likes, followers, views, and comments—across platforms. Think of it as a command center for engagement boosters, content visibility, and analytics.
